baxi WM 511 RS?

The water In the cylinder is heating to 80 degrees and possibly more there is obviously a valve sticking or broken could you point me in the right direction as to which one.

How you conclude that there is obviously a valve sticking or broken I do not know. I don't reach that conclusion but then again - I know next to nothing of boilers and heating systems.

Heated water from the boiler is directed to a coil in the hot water cylinder and back to the boiler. The flow will stop when the hot water in the tank reaches the desired temperature - there will probably be a thermostat strapped to the side of the tank that controls the firing of the boiler - it may be set to 80 degrees or it may be defective - check it out.

There should also be a thermostat control on the boiler itself to set the temperature of the water being pumped around the pipes - too hot and the risk is being burned by the radiators.
